    Title: F-Lie Algebras: Classification of Cubic Extensions of the Poincaré Algebras
    Author: M. Rausch de Traubenberg
    Comments: 6 pages, no figures
    Abstract:
    Lie algebras of order F (or F-Lie algebras) are possible generalisations of Lie algebras (F=1) and Lie superalgebras (F=2). These structures have been used to implement new non-trivial extensions of the Poincaré algebra in quantum field theory. A systematic method to obtain all Lie algebras of order 3 associated to iso(1,3) the four-dimensional Poincaré algebra, is given..

    Title: FQH Droplets Wave Function on Spheres
    Authors: R. Ahl Laamara, L.B Drissi, E.H Saidi
    Comments: 7 pages, no figures
    Abstract:
    Using matrix model formulation of Laughlin fluid as well as su(2) representation theory, we consider fractional Quantum Hall system on 3d and 2d spheres and derive explicitly the ground state wave function of the corresponding fluid droplets.
    Keywords: FQHE, Matrix model, Higher dimensions, Ground state wave function, Conifold.

    Title: Topological SL( 2) Gauge Theory on Conifold
    Authors: El Hassan Saidi

    Comments: 21 pages, no figures

    Abstract:

    Using a two component SL( 2) isospinor formalism, we study the explicit link between conifold $T^{\ast}{\mathbb{S}}^{3}$ and q-deformed non commutative holomorphic geometry in complex four dimensions. Then, thinking about conifold as a projective complex three dimension hypersurface embedded in non compact $WP^{5}( 1,-1,1,-1,1,-1) $ space and using conifold local isometries, we study topological SL( 2) gauge theory on $T^{\ast} {\mathbb{S}}^{3}$ and its reductions to lower dimension sub-manifolds $T^{\ast} {\mathbb{S}}^{2}$, $T^{\ast} {\mathbb{S}}^{1}$ and their real slices. Projective symmetry is also used to build a supersymmetric QFT _{4}$ realization of these backgrounds. Extensions for higher dimensions with conifold like properties are explored.
    Key words: Conifold, q-deformation, non commutative complex geometry, topological gauge theory. Nambu like background.
